Shayan Genealogy

OriginsThe origins of the Shayan surname can be traced back to Iran, where it is derived from Persian roots. The name is associated with Iranian culture and is commonly found among individuals of Persian descent.
Geographic DistributionThe Shayan surname is most popular in Iran, where it has a significant presence. It may also be found among the Iranian diaspora in countries such as the United States, Canada, and the United Kingdom.
VariationsVariations of the Shayan surname include Shayannejad and Shayani, reflecting regional and linguistic variations within the Persian-speaking world.
